All tested features are supported. + +## Limits and Comparison + +This is a feature list of pybind11 for pocketpy. It lists all completed and pending features. It also lists the features that cannot be implemented in the current version of pocketpy. + +### [Function](https://pybind11.readthedocs.io/en/stable/advanced/functions.html) + +- [x] Function overloading +- [x] Return value policy +- [x] is_prepend +- [x] `*args` and `**kwargs` +- [ ] Keep-alive +- [ ] Call Guard +- [x] Default arguments +- [ ] Keyword-Only arguments +- [ ] Positional-Only arguments +- [ ] Allow/Prohibiting None arguments + +### [Class](https://pybind11.readthedocs.io/en/stable/classes.html) + +- [x] Creating bindings for a custom type +- [x] Binding lambda functions +- [x] Dynamic attributes +- [x] Inheritance and automatic downcasting +- [x] Enumerations and internal types +- [ ] Instance and static fields + +> Binding static fields may never be implemented in pocketpy because it requires a metaclass, which is a heavy and infrequently used feature. + +### [Exceptions](https://pybind11.readthedocs.io/en/stable/advanced/exceptions.html) + +Need further discussion. + +### [Smart pointers](https://pybind11.readthedocs.io/en/stable/advanced/smart_ptrs.html) + +- [ ] std::shared_ptr +- [ ] std::unique_ptr +- [ ] Custom smart pointers + +### [Type conversions](https://pybind11.readthedocs.io/en/stable/advanced/cast/index.html) + +- [x] Python built-in types +- [x] STL Containers +- [ ] Functional +- [ ] Chrono + +### [Python C++ interface](https://pybind11.readthedocs.io/en/stable/advanced/pycpp/object.html) + +Need further discussion. + +- [x] `object` +- [x] `none` +- [x] `type` +- [x] `bool_` +- [x] `int_` +- [x] `float_` +- [x] `str` +- [ ] `bytes` +- [ ] `bytearray` +- [x] `tuple` +- [x] `list` +- [ ] `set` +- [x] `dict` +- [ ] `slice` +- [x] `iterable` +- [x] `iterator` +- [ ] `function` +- [ ] `buffer` +- [ ] `memoryview` +- [x] `capsule` + +### [Miscellaneous](https://pybind11.readthedocs.io/en/stable/advanced/misc.html) + +- [ ] Global Interpreter Lock (GIL) +- [ ] Binding sequence data types, iterators, the slicing protocol, etc. +- [x] Convenient operators binding + +### Differences between CPython and pocketpy + +- only `add`, `sub` and `mul` have corresponding right versions in pocketpy. So if you bind `int() >> py::self`, it will has no effect in pocketpy. + +- `__new__` and `__del__` are not supported in pocketpy. + +- in-place operators, such as `+=`, `-=`, `*=`, etc., are not supported in pocketpy. + +- thre return value of `globals` is immutable in pocketpy. \ No newline at end of file
